**Q: Where is the evacuation-chair store and who can open it?**

A: The evacuation-chair store is on level 5 of Thornvale House, next to the east stairwell. Two chairs are kept there; a third is on level 2. Team assistants acting as floor marshals may open the store during drills and real evacuations only. Check the chairs monthly against the inspection sheet on the inside of the door and report faults to the facilities desk. Do not remove chairs for any other purpose. The store is locked with the code below.

badge for fafop-fajof: bdg-Z-47

The Kotlin and Swift SDKs for Brindlewave's notification service have drifted: the Kotlin client supports batched acknowledgments while Swift does not. Parity work is blocked because the staging credentials used by the cross-SDK integration suite expired last Thursday. Both SDKs must authenticate against the same Relayhut endpoint to validate identical behavior. Security review is requested on the replacement credential scope, which has been narrowed to read-only event polling. The reissued key for the Relayhut staging tier is as follows.

API key for yahig-tadup: kto7_ubizbYm

Meeting notes (excerpt) — Depot Uniform Rollout. Quick recap from Tuesday: the new Harrowfen depot opens in three weeks, and Jessa confirmed the uniform order with Calder Workwear is complete — jackets, hi-vis vests, and winter liners, all sized per the staff survey. Tomas will handle distribution lockers. One snag: the embroidered badges arrived separately and need to travel with the main shipment. For the records team, please log the courier arrangement below. Hand-over instruction follows:

dispatch memo: the fenael gormir courier leaves the kelath ledger at gate 7035 under passcode 975267